21 G E T A C L U E: Lear ning the Lingo Glossar y 3-pointer: A shot ma de from beyond th e 3-point line . It’s worth three points in stead of the usual two poin ts. Alley-oop: A pass that is thrown towar d the basket, the n caught in mid air and put into th e basket by a teammate befor e he touches th e ground again.
23 Rebound: T o get control o f the ball after a missed shot. Rock: The bask etball. Roll: The m ost common type of screen play . The screen er will move , or “roll,” to the bask et with the inten tion of receivin g the pass for the easy layup or dunk.
25 Positions Center (C): Plays closest to the basket an d tries to block the ball. Us ually the tallest person on the team. Also called the “pivot.” Point Guard (PG): Of the two gua rds, h e is the better ballhandler . Also called a “playma ker” because he runs the offens e.
